Advanced Methods and Techniques in Plant Science and Biotechnology
ECTS: 5. Niveau: Kandidat. Dato: 19.-30. august (Written exam should be handed in online or per mail 2 weeks after the course). Sted: Flakkeberg.
The Danish and global plant production is facing major challenges. The rapid population growth, the increased consumption of animal products and the use of crops for energy purposes demand an increased production. Plant biotechnology is expected to play a major role in meeting the demands created by this scenario through knowledge on plant genomes, advanced molecular breeding and development of genetic modified organisms (GMO). The course will cover state of the art techniques and methods within plant biotechnology research, including the genetic basis of several important plant properties and the use of molecular genetics and genetically modified organisms (GMO). Introduction to Using C. Elegans as Model Organism in Biomedical Research
ECTS: 5. Niveau: Kandidat. Dato: 5.-21. august. Sted: Aarhus.
The small soil nematode Carnorhabditis elegans is a popular genetic model organism used in laboratories worldwide to study complex biological processes such as for example aging, apoptosis and neurobiology. The course will provide a practical introduction to using C. elegans in biomedical research. The course participants will have hands on experience with popular techniques such as RNAi, genetic crosses, transgenic and GFP reporter strains. Furthermore, the course participants will be able to inactive their own gene of interest in C. elegans using RNAi. Thus, during the course the participants will not only be familiarized with using C. elegans as model organism but also be able to evaluate if C. elegans can be used to advance their own ongoing and future studies. Mitochondria in Aging and Disease
ECTS: 5. Niveau: Kandidat. Dato: 8.-19. juli (Written exam can be handed in per mail). Sted: Aarhus.
The course will cover a broad range of aspects of mitochondrial function and biology. It will introduce the students to the current knowledge on mitochondria metabolism and especially emphasize the involvement of mitochondrial dysfunction in disease processes as well as the aging process. The role of mitochondria in oxidative stress will be presented and mitochondrial maintenance mechanisms, mitochondrial dynamics, specific mitochondrial proteins and the mitochondrial proteome will be discussed. Finally, various methods for studying mitochondria and their functions will be presented and the applicability of the methods will be discussed.
